    So, back in the good old days you could camp anywhere across Australia, but as public lands and state forests moved into National parks free camping has significantly disappeared. This is a major issue happening in Victoria today with the Great Forest Nation Park proposal.
    In WA free camping (unless assigned by Gov) is illegal and currently carries a $1000 fine. Some argue this is revenue raising for both tourist operators and aboriginal communities, but regardless it does make travel unviable for some.
    There is also the senseless. For example in the Nuytsland Nature Reserve WA it will take you 2 - 3 days driving to follow the Old Telegraph track and yet ALL Camping is prohibited. Obviously people simply ignore the law.
    But when you travel Australia you also learn about the dark side, and some of that dark side is Australia really is increasingly only a country for the wealthy. As such, I think if you cant afford to be paying for accommodation in WA when there is no allocated free camping then you probably shouldn't be there.

      Hi, we use a chemical toilet but don’t put chemical in it so we have the option to dig a hole and bury it if needed, we try to empty it frequently (every 1 to 2 days) so it doesn’t really smell. We don’t have a hot water system, cold showers most of the time, if water is too cold we boil a kettle lol . We carry 80 L but when we can we use creek water instead of our drinking water, how many showers we get is difficult to answer depending on where you’re camping and how long for, some places you have to be economical because you can’t get water so maybe you won’t shower for a couple of days….when we do use our water we use 10L each…..we show system in our 4month review ua-cam.com/video/_R3HOrAxNQU/v-deo.htmlsi=5YvNu1xeUpd2akro
